You will find a number of excellent recreational opportunities in Tipton. The 33-acre City Park is home to the Tipton 'Tigers' football field and track, a lighted softball diamond, tennis courts, horseshoe courts, new playground equipment, a disc golf course, youth ball diamonds, and three pavilions with adjacent fireplaces. There are a number of additional recreational and park facilities associated with Tipton Community Schools.

A view of the Kennedy Family Aquatic Center from high above the fun.The Kennedy Family Aquatic Center, completed in summer of 2005, is a state-of-the-art recreation complex and is the only indoor/outdoor aquatic facility in the region. It consists of a zero-depth-entry outdoor pool complete with a speed slide and double flume slide, a lazy river, a six-lane competition-size indoor pool, and an impressive concession area complete with grassy areas and many umbrella tables for poolside enjoyment. Tipton's Recreation Department not only manages and oversees the Aquatic Center, but also offers a wide range of recreation programs for youth and adults alike. Everything from youth soccer, basketball and tee-ball to an adult sand volleyball league is offered. This level of recreation service is extremely rare for a community the size of Tipton, and is a testament to the City's committment to enhancing its residents' quality of life.
